Zespół: Technology Rodzaj umowy: Pracownik Opis stanowiska About the job Our team drives the solutions that build a modern, secure, and resilient workplace ecosystem for Allegro employees across the whole Group. As a collaborative team of Systems Engineers and Systems Administrators, we develop the digital workplace environment, powering services such as endpoint management, printing, CCTV, corporate password manager, and many more. We oversee the management, security, and health of all endpoint devices such as macOS/Windows workstations, iOS/Android mobile devices. Our scope also covers infrastructure and internal process automation using modern scripting, managing secure remote access, and scaling our virtual workplace infrastructure. We are also constantly exploring emerging technologies, including AI capabilities, to build smarter services. We work in close collaboration with both highly technical and business teams across the organization, participating in various projects from requirements and system design to final implementation. Our ultimate goal is to create a seamless, best-in-class digital workplace environment that empowers our employees and drives Allegro's growth. Important things for you Flexible working hours in the hybrid model (4/1) - working hours start between 7:00 a.m. and 10:00 a.m. We also have 30 days of occasional remote work. Our team is mostly based in Poznan. What will your job involve? Owning and managing complex IT infrastructure services. Designing macro-level architecture and blueprints for new systems, focusing on how different technologies integrate flawlessly, scale, and remain highly available. Managing the full lifecycle of features and services, from initial requirement elicitation and analysis to final system deployment. Designing, implementing, and optimizing proactive monitoring and alerting systems to stay ahead of potential infrastructure anomalies. Automating troubleshooting processes and performing complex root cause analysis on distributed, large-scale systems. Leading and executing key IT infrastructure migration, upgrade, and modernization projects across international environments. Preparing, expanding, and maintaining clear technical documentation, procedures, and task tracking for complex systems Collaborating closely with specialized domain teams across the organization, such as corporate network, security, and IT support. Participating in a 24h on-duty rotation scheme - remaining available via phone and computer to resolve critical service issues outside of core working hours. You’ll be a great fit if you bring: Expert-level knowledge of managing large-scale endpoint environments. Extensive experience with cloud platforms, Windows Server RDS services, and modern virtualization/container platforms (Docker). Strong proficiency in writing scripts (PowerShell / Bash / Python) with a continuous drive toward automation, optimization, and AI-assisted operations. Deep skills in privilege management, building security rules, managing permission sets, and establishing endpoint compliance. The ability to transition smoothly from day-to-day operations to an engineering and systems-thinking mindset, mapping out the "big picture". Strong time management and project management skills, with the capability to autonomously lead projects and seamlessly cooperate with technical and business stakeholders. Great teamwork abilities, minimum B2 English communication skills, and an orientation toward building long-term, supportive business relationships with internal clients and vendors. A degree in Computer Science or equivalent professional training combined with proven experience in a similar position. Proactivity and a readiness for occasional business trips to work face-to-face with specialized teams across different company locations. You will meet the Allegro Scale, which starts with over 1000 microservices, an open-source data bus (Hermes) with 300K+ rps, a Service Mesh with 1M+ rps, tens of petabytes of data, and production-used machine learning. You will become part of Allegro Tech - We speak at industry conferences, cooperate with tech communities, run our own blog (it's been over 10 years!), record podcasts, lead guilds, and we organize our own internal conference - the Allegro Tech Meeting.
